1a is a mid-terrace house in Shelton Lock, Derby, Derby (DE24 9FR). It has a recorded floor area of 46 m² (around 495 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1900-1929. The latest certificate (December 2022) shows a C (score 73). The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since October 2012.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Poor. At 46 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 27 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 43–113 m². The building's EPC ratings span F to B across 27 units on file.

At 46 m² it's 27.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(64 m² median across 26 EPCs).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 73% of similar EPCs).

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ry

That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
